A react package to generate HTML for conversion to Email or PDF from shared components

import ts from 'typescript'; import fs, { readFileSync } from 'fs'; import React from 'react'; import ReactDOMServer from 'react-dom/server'; import path from 'path'; import postcss from 'postcss'; import tailwindcss from 'tailwindcss'; import autoprefixer from 'autoprefixer'; import pkg from 'js-beautify'; import { minify } from 'html-minifier'; const { html: beautify } = pkg; // Console colors const colors = { reset: '\x1b[0m', blue: '\x1b[34m', green: '\x1b[32m', red: '\x1b[31m', }; // Replace camelCase with kebab-case function toKebabCase(str) { return str.replace(/([a-z0-9])([A-Z])/g, '$1-$2').toLowerCase(); } // Transpile modules function transpileModule(filePath) { const tsConfig = { jsx: ts.JsxEmit.React, esModuleInterop: true, module: ts.ModuleKind.ESNext, target: ts.ScriptTarget.ESNext, }; const fileContents = fs.readFileSync(filePath, 'utf8'); const transpiled = ts.transpileModule(fileContents, { compilerOptions: tsConfig }); return transpiled.outputText; } // Function to generate critical CSS using Tailwind and PurgeCSS async function generateCriticalCSS(htmlContent, userSettings) { // Load global styles if specified let globalStyles = ''; if (userSettings.globalStyles) { console.log(`→ Loading global styles from ${userSettings.globalStyles}`); try { globalStyles = readFileSync(userSettings.globalStyles, 'utf8'); } catch (err) { console.error(`Error loading global styles from ${userSettings.globalStyles}:`, err); } } const css = `${globalStyles} @tailwind base; @tailwind components; @tailwind utilities;`; return postcss([ tailwindcss(), autoprefixer({ overrideBrowserslist: ['last 2 versions', '> 1%'], grid: true }), ]) .process(css, { from: undefined }) .then((result) => result.css); } export const renderReactToHTML = async () => { console.log(`${colors.blue}Building...${colors.reset}`); /** * Load the user settings from the tohtml.config.js file * located in the root of the project */ const userSettingsPath = `${process.cwd()}/tohtml.config.js`; let userSettings; try { const module = await import(userSettingsPath); userSettings = module.settings; } catch (error) { console.error(`Error loading the react-to-html configuration file from ${userSettingsPath}`); console.error(error); process.exit(1); } /** * Create the build directory if it doesn't exist * This is where the generated HTML files will be saved */ const outputDir = userSettings.outputDir || 'build-html'; if (!fs.existsSync(outputDir)) { console.log(`${colors.blue}Creating the build directory...${colors.reset}`); fs.mkdirSync(outputDir); } console.log(' '); /** * Loop through the content array in the user settings * and process each component */ for (const [index, contentItem] of userSettings.content.entries()) { const componentBaseName = contentItem.path.split('/').pop()?.replace(/\.tsx$/, '') || `Component ${index + 1}`; console.log(`${colors.reset}∴ Processing ${componentBaseName}...${colors.reset}`); /** * Transpile the component file to JavaScript */ console.log("→ Transpiling the component..."); const componentFullPath = path.resolve(process.cwd(), contentItem.path); const componentDir = path.dirname(componentFullPath); // Get directory of the component const tempFilePath = path.join(componentDir, `tempComponent${index}.mjs`); // Create temp file path in the same directory const transpiledCode = transpileModule(componentFullPath); fs.writeFileSync(tempFilePath, transpiledCode); /** * Render the component to HTML * and save the output to a file */ try { // Start timer const startTime = Date.now(); // Load the component const Component = (await import(tempFilePath)).default; const componentContent = ReactDOMServer.renderToStaticMarkup(React.createElement(Component, contentItem.props)); // Generate CSS const css = await generateCriticalCSS(componentContent, userSettings); console.log("✔ Generated critical CSS"); // Default decorator const defaultDecorator = (content, styles) => { return ` <!DOCTYPE html> <html> <head> <meta charset="UTF-8"> <meta name="viewport" content="width=device-width, initial-scale=1.0"> <style> body, html { height: ${userSettings.pageHeight ? userSettings.pageHeight : 'auto'}; width: ${userSettings.pageWidth ? userSettings.pageWidth : '100%'}; margin: 0; padding: 0; box-sizing: border-box; font-family: system-ui, sans-serif; } ${styles} </style> </head> <body> ${content} </body> </html> `; }; // Decorate the component const decorate = userSettings.decorator ? userSettings.decorator : defaultDecorator; let htmlOutput = decorate(componentContent, css); // Format the output if (userSettings.outputFormat === 'minified') { htmlOutput = minify(htmlOutput, { removeAttributeQuotes: true, collapseWhitespace: true, removeComments: true, minifyCSS: true, }); } else if (userSettings.outputFormat === 'pretty') { htmlOutput = beautify(htmlOutput, { indent_size: 2 }); } // Rename the component file to kebab-case const kebabComponentName = toKebabCase(componentBaseName); const filename = `${kebabComponentName}.html`; // Save the output to a file fs.writeFileSync(`${outputDir}/${filename}`, htmlOutput); // End timer const duration = Date.now() - startTime; // Log success message console.log(`${colors.green}✔ Successfully processed ${colors.reset}${componentBaseName} ${colors.green}in ${duration}ms${colors.reset}`); console.log(' '); } finally { if (fs.existsSync(tempFilePath)) { fs.unlinkSync(tempFilePath); } } } // Log completion message console.log(' '); console.log(`${colors.green}✔ Complete!${colors.reset}`); console.log(`→ Your components have been built to ./${outputDir}/`); console.log(' '); };
